Your long term goal isn't unrealistic, but as you get closer to it, you can always re-evaluate it and adjust the goal as you need to in order to account for bone size, muscle mass, how you feel, etc.

I have found being committed is the #1 key to changing my lifestyle. Seeing results is a reminder that what we're doing is the right thing! I started like you, by just reducing my portions, but then I got a bit more serious about it and started counting calories. I never wanted to do that, didn't want to get 'obsessed' however, I think I was in denial over how much I was eating even when I *thought* I was being good. By keeping track, I know how much I can eat and still lose weight, and I eat whatever I want - and if that means having pizza with my family then I do it - without guilt - I just know when I need to stop, and really, in the long term scheme of things, that's what we NEED to know in order to keep the weight off.

so i've noticed that everyone in here is all about the fruits and veggies, why? it may be a stupid question, but there it is. are some better than others, is it just for the nutritional value or can they help you lose weight?

That said, have a nice day! :rolleyes:
 
Most fruits and veggies are good for you. One kind of exception that comes to mind is the avocado, which is high in fat but has other nutrients that are good for you.

The great thing about fruits and veggies are that they are low in calories and in most cases contain little to no fat. Which means you can fill up on those (as long as they're prepared properly i.e. not deep fat fried or covered in sugar). Usually the fruits and veggies that are higher in nutrients are also deeper in color.

For example, carrots are a very deep color and are packed with nutrients, and iceberg lettuce is very pale green and has very little nutritional value. This is not to say that eating iceberg lettuce is bad for you. It's actually good for you, especially if you're replacing fries with a side salad.

Still with me, great! :D Eating fruits and veggies may not necessarily help you lose weight. It's all about making better choices. Another example, if you are replacing, say, a peach for a snickers, you're saving yourself about 300 calories. So theoretically, you could eat 6 or 7 peaches for that one candy bar. Bet you'd have killed that sweet tooth and gotten pretty full in the process. Pretty good deal, huh. So, in that aspect, yes, you could say that they help you lose weight. You're going to find that by adding fruits and especially veggies to your diet that you're going to be able to have more food and stay full for longer.
